pyqt5-QScrollBar

1、介绍

这是一个进度条组件,两侧点击可以加减。

2、使用

setMinimum(self, a0: int)
  • 设置最小值,可以是负值
setMaximum(self, a0: int)
  • 设置最大值,可以是超过1000*1000
  • 设置浮点数时,保留其整数部分
value(self) -> int
  • 返回进度条的数值,int类型。
  • 默认时最小为0,最大为99。两侧点击,加减的单位是1
  • 设置最大值为1000时,两侧点击,加减的单位仍是1,最大可以为1000
  • 设置最小值为-100时,默认值为0,最小可以为-100

3、事件

valueChanged(self, value: int) [signal] 
  • value接收的改变后的值
  • 如果是点击两侧的按钮,会且只会触发一次该事件
  • 拖拽进度条时,会触发多次该事件,具体次数不定
  • setValue方法也可以触发该事件
posted @ 2023-11-06 22:11  挖洞404  阅读(61)  评论(0编辑  收藏  举报